CHARLES SILLEM LIDDERDALE WATERCOLOR PAINTING 1883 - Charles Sillem Lidderdale, English, 1831 to 1895, a Victorian watercolor on paper painting depicting a young girl in a wooded landscape, wearing a white mob cap with a pink bow, 1883. Painted in a delicate color palette with very fine details. Signed with a monogram and dated lower right. Housed in an original period gilt wood and gesso frame. Charles Sillem Lidderdale was a British artist whose work often focused on portraits of young women in outdoor settings. Lidderdale exhibited 36 paintings at the Royal Academy between 1856 and 1893.
